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Basement: Larger basements require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Soil Condition: Poor soil conditions may require additional preparation and stabilization, adding to the expense.
- Accessibility of the Site: Difficult-to-access sites can lead to higher labor costs and longer project timelines.
- Concrete Quality: Higher-grade concrete offers better durability but comes at a higher price.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Athens, GA can vary, impacting the total c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Obtaining necessary permits and passing inspections can add to the overall expense.
- Additional Features: Features like waterproofing, insulation, and drainage systems will increase costs.

Task | Average Cost (Athens, GA) |
---|---|
Excavation |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Concrete Pouring | $5,000 - $10,000 |
Waterproofing |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Insulation | $1,200 - $2,500 |
Drainage System Installation | $1,500 - $3,500 |
Permits and Inspections | $500 - $1,000 |
